Another really flavoursome mix is onion, mushroom and tomato only - I used to saute it up and serve it over a bunch of fresh cooked asparagus, OR make an eggplant, tomato, roasted red capsicum and onion ragout. It's more like a meatless meaty stew.  Both a bit of a change from stir fry.

I recommend the lemon creme dessert from Opti (I was allowed to have a small amount of passionfruit and berries so they went really well with it) but also you could have diet jelly if you can stand the taste.

Pre-Op Radid Lose Optifast Diet 355206 Well my surgery date is the 11th May, I am booked in with Dr Russell in Rockhampton Qld. I have to do the Optifast diet for 5 weeks. 4 Opti products a day.

Today is day 15 or day 1 of week 3 as I preferred to count them :D

First week I lost 4.4 kg, week 2 I lose 1.7kg so that a total of 6.1kg - feel awesome today!!   It hasn't been easy - in the last 2 weeks I have been tired, cranky and very emotionally at times..... and the headaches and lack of energy have been unbelievable at times.

I have learnt a few do's and don'ts.  Like drinking water is a must - adding mints leaves and lime makes it so much easier to drink the 2litres a day.   Adding ice to my shake - crushing the ice first, and then add the water and then the shake mix... ends up like a flappe - so much nicer to drink.  I also have discovered that a bar is much more satisfying than a shake - seem to fill me up for longer.  Also it is a great product to practice the small bites and eating slower.
